    Abstract: A length (c) of a melamine foamed block (12) to be accommodated in an ink tank housing (11) as measured in the longitudinal direction is dimensioned to be larger than a length (C) of the ink tank housing (11) as measured in the longitudinal direction. Thus, while the foamed block (12) is accommodated in the ink tank housing (11), it is compressed in the direction orienting toward an ink feeding port (13) from which ink is fed to a printing head (14), i.e., in the ink feeding direction. Consequently, the ink retaining force induced by the capillary force is not intensified in the compressing direction of the melamine foamed block (12), resulting in an ink feeding capability of the printing head (14) being improved. On the contrary, the ink retaining force effective at a right angle relative to the compressing direction of the melamine foamed block (12) is intensified.

    Abstract: An ink supply mechanism which supplies ink from an ink container (19) for storing ink to an ink discharging unit (17) which discharges ink comprises a first filter (70) member provided in an ink outlet section of the ink container; an ink supply passage (52) which conductively connects an ink jet recording unit and the ink container (19) for supplying ink from the ink container reservoir portion to the ink jet recording unit; and a second filter member (63) provided in the ink supply passage between the ink discharging ports and the first filter member (70). The second filter member (63) is provided with holes which create the capillary force greater than the negative pressure in the ink container. With the above structure, it is possible to provide an ink jet recording apparatus capable of making the recovery amount compatible between a usual recording means and a recording means of a high-speed type, making a recording means of a high-speed type usable in a usual recording apparatus, and improving the ink usage efficiency in the recovery process.

    Abstract: An ink jet recording apparatus includes an orifice (5) for ejecting ink (6); a heater (4) for generating thermal energy to produce a bubble (8) to eject the ink; an ink passage (1) for supplying ink to the orifice (5), the ink passage being provided with the heater (4); an ink container (7) for containing ink to be supplied to the ink passage (1), the ink container retaining the ink, using capillary force; wherein the following is satisfied: VOH > V'Me + Vd where VOH is a volume of the ink passage (1) from the orifice (5) to an edge of the heater adjacent the orifice; V'Me is a volume of a meniscus retraction at an initial ink ejection; and Vd is a volume of ejected ink.
